Output d592f8a00e420484d409a81625d90abdda9f4cde4965063630bc3b5a5a1a75ad:0

value
688540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7bb961d7df6bb782e296f36cb64ac55bc6dc22 OP_EQUALVERIFY OP_CHECKSIG
address
1MHPE6Gx1DwJP4T8qR3TExBP8e2fAjTpyx
transaction
d592f8a00e420484d409a81625d90abdda9f4cde4965063630bc3b5a5a1a75ad
confirmations
424685
spent
true